Top Attractions

London is home to some of the world’s most famous landmarks, and many of them are easily accessible by Tube. From the iconic Big Ben and the Houses of Parliament to the stunning Tower Bridge and the historic Buckingham Palace, there are plenty of must-see attractions to explore. You can also take a ride on the London Eye for a bird’s-eye view of the city, or visit the British Museum to see some of the world’s most impressive art and artifacts.

Food Scene

London is a food lover’s paradise, with a diverse range of cuisines and dining options to suit every taste and budget. From traditional fish and chips to modern fusion cuisine, there’s something for everyone. Be sure to check out the famous Borough Market for some of the city’s best street food, or head to Brick Lane for a taste of the city’s vibrant curry scene.

Budget-Friendly Tips

London can be an expensive city, but there are plenty of ways to save money without sacrificing fun. Consider purchasing a Visitor Oyster Card for discounted travel on the Tube, or take advantage of free entry to many of the city’s museums and galleries. You can also find affordable food options by exploring the city’s street markets or seeking out local pubs.

Historical Landmarks

London has a rich history that can be seen in its many landmarks and monuments. Take a walk through the Tower of London to learn about the city’s royal past, or visit the Churchill War Rooms to see where Winston Churchill led Britain during World War II. You can also explore the city’s many historic churches, including St. Paul’s Cathedral and Westminster Abbey.

Local Markets

London is home to some of the world’s most famous markets, where you can find everything from vintage clothes to fresh produce. Be sure to check out the famous Camden Market for some of the city’s best street food and unique shopping, or explore the Portobello Market for a taste of the city’s eclectic fashion scene.
